Web7 feb. 2024 · Roth rule changes Roth employer plan distributions. Prior to the SECURE Act 2.0, Roth IRA owners were exempt from taking RMDs. However, Roth accounts in employer plans, such as 401(k)s and 403(b)s were not exempt from the RMD rule. WebThe Standard Web13 apr. 2024 · Traditional vs. Roth accounts. 401(k)s and IRAs both offer a traditional and Roth version. Traditional accounts are tax deferred, meaning that you contribute pre-tax dollars and reduce your current income tax bill. Web13 apr. 2024 · An IRA is a retirement savings plan. There are several types of IRAs: traditional IRAs, Roth IRAs, simplified employee pension (SEP) IRAs, and savings incentive match plans for employees (SIMPLE) IRAs. Traditional and Roth IRAs are established by individuals who are allowed to contribute earnings up to a set maximum dollar amount.
